This could mean memory that corresponds to several nodes might fall in memblock reserved regions. Kernels compiled with CONFIG_DEFERRED_STRUCT_PAGE_INIT will initialize only certain size memory per node. The certain size takes into account the dentry and inode cache sizes. Currently the cache sizes are calculated based on the total system memory including the reserved memory. However such a kernel when booting the same kernel as fadump kernel will not be able to allocate the required amount of memory to suffice for the dentry and inode caches. This results in crashes like the below on large systems such as 32 TB systems.
